Have a hex Mosin and removed the rear sight down to the dovetail. Found some rings for mounting a scout scope and the thing is an absolute TACK DRIVER for about 5-10 shots. Then the scope has been pounded forward by the recoil. Reset it twice and both times would slide forward after a few shots. Filed a groove in the rear ring mount so I could pin it with the rear pin hole and the mount "jumped" the pin and slid forward again and I lost the pin to boot.

This is a great shooting gun, but I can't keep a scope on it for more than 5-10 shots.

Anyone know of a picatinny mount that would fit the dovetail and use the Mosins pins to hold it?

The problem you are having may have to do with the shape of the dovetail. The dovetail on mine tapered. It measured 11.5 mm at the front and 12.5 at the rear. This may mean that your clamping force is less at the front than at the rear.

Those BKL mounts are one piece base and rings, which means there is less to loosen up. They also apply force against the entire dovetail instead of one small spot.
